Understanding Zeronito In The Nicotine Free Pouch Landscape

Wondering where Zeronito actually sits among nicotine-free pouches? The category can look crowded, yet the brands are not all doing the same thing. Formats vary, flavour profiles differ, and the way each name positions itself says a lot about who it is for. Taking a closer look at these basics helps place Zeronito in a clearer, more realistic context.

Format and overall positioning

First, it helps to think about format. Nicotine-free pouches usually mimic the look and feel of regular oral pouches, aiming for a familiar experience without the active ingredient. The range (sold as Zeronito) follows that general template, sitting alongside other white pouch options that focus on mouthfeel, moisture level and discretion rather than strength. From the outside, it comes across as a straightforward, category-standard take rather than an experimental outlier. This puts it in the mainstream of nicotine-free products rather than in a niche corner aimed at hobbyists or flavour collectors.

Flavour direction and sensory focus

Flavour is where most nicotine-free pouch brands try to stand out. Across the market, users see the same broad families over and over again, such as minty, fruity or more neutral profiles. Zeronito fits inside that pattern rather than breaking away from it. The emphasis is on recognisable, accessible tastes instead of unusual combinations. For someone used to typical pouch flavours, that makes the line-up feel intuitive and easy to understand. On the flip side, people chasing very experimental or gourmet-style profiles may see it as a relatively conservative option compared with some smaller, more adventurous names that push bolder blends or limited releases.

How it compares within the category

Looking at the wider nicotine-free space, brands tend to compete on three main things beyond flavour and format. They highlight the overall experience in the lip, they lean heavily on styling and branding, or they build a broader ecosystem around their products with extras and strong community content. Zeronito appears to lean most on straightforward usability and clear labelling rather than on loud design or lifestyle-heavy storytelling. That makes it attractive to someone who simply wants a pouch that behaves in a familiar way without needing to buy into a whole identity or narrative. At the same time, that low-key approach can make it blend into the shelf when placed next to more visually aggressive brands. In simple terms, it looks like a practical, middle-of-the-road choice within the nicotine-free segment. It is not the most hyped or the most experimental, but it is consistent with what many users already expect from this format. For people trying to map the category, that grounded, unsensational positioning is useful to know and helps set realistic expectations.
